Neo, I can tell you that the JG pump is NOT an insert style. You would be thinking of the JF and JE, and from what I've read in the past, I'm pretty sure they use a different shaped mold than Panther. Most likely reason for your bellhousing being a Berkeley Pack-a-jet housing would be that Panther must have used the same size front bearing housing as Berkeley. If not they would have had to cast up their own bellhousings.
